Chatting online with friends can be a great way to stay connected, even when you’re not able to meet in person. With the right tools, it’s easy to create an environment where everyone feels comfortable and has fun.

The first step is finding the right platform for your group. There are many different options available, from text-based chat rooms like Discord or Slack to video call services like Zoom or Skype. Consider what type of communication would work best for your group – do you want more casual conversations? Or would something more structured work better? Finally, set some ground rules so that everyone knows how they should behave while chatting online with their friends. This could include things such as no personal attacks or language restrictions; also consider setting up a moderator who can help keep conversations on track if needed. Establishing these rules will ensure that all participants feel safe and respected during each session – this will make sure everybody has an enjoyable experience!
